# Adoption Certification Scorecard
|
||||
|
||||
Template for independent verification that APOPHIS is ready for company-wide enforcement.
|
||||
|
||||
## Reviewer Profiles
|
||||
|
||||
Conduct reviews across four personas:
|
||||
|
||||
1. **LLM-heavy platform** — Teams using AI-generated code and automated contract scaffolding
|
||||
2. **No-LLM DX** — Traditional development teams who write contracts by hand
|
||||
3. **Skeptical QA** — Quality engineers who need deterministic replay and artifact trust
|
||||
4. **Startup full-stack** — Small teams who need fast setup and minimal configuration
|
||||
|
||||
## Scorecard Dimensions
|
||||
|
||||
Rate each dimension from **1 (poor)** to **5 (excellent)**.
|
||||
|
||||
| Dimension | Description | Weight |
|
||||
|-----------|-------------|--------|
|
||||
| Setup friction | Time and steps to first successful `verify` run | 20% |
|
||||
| Time-to-first-value | How quickly the team sees actionable contract feedback | 20% |
|
||||
| CI confidence | Trust that green CI means working software | 20% |
|
||||
| Replay reliability | Ability to reproduce failures deterministically | 20% |
|
||||
| Documentation quality | Clarity and accuracy of docs vs actual behavior | 10% |
|
||||
| Monorepo ergonomics | Ease of use in multi-package workspaces | 10% |

## Command Transcripts
|
||||
|
||||
### Setup (all personas)
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
npm install apophis-fastify
|
||||
npx apophis --help # exits 0
|
||||
npx apophis init # writes scaffold
|
||||
npx apophis doctor # passes
|
||||
npx apophis verify # first run with feedback
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
### Deterministic Replay (Skeptical QA)
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
npx apophis verify --seed 42 --depth quick
|
||||
# On failure:
|
||||
npx apophis replay --artifact apophis-artifacts/verify-*.json
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
### CI Workflow (example)
|
||||
```yaml
|
||||
- run: npx apophis verify --format json-summary
|
||||
- uses: actions/upload-artifact@v4
|
||||
if: failure()
|
||||
with:
|
||||
path: apophis-artifacts/
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
### Time Measurements
|
||||
- Install to first help: < 30s
|
||||
- Init to first verify: < 2 minutes
|
||||
- Quick verify run: < 10s per 10 routes
|
||||
- Replay from artifact: < 5s
